Abstract

Non-formal education seeks to address the limitations of formal education that do not reach all communities and do not provide all new competencies and capabilities that are essential for the integrated development of communities. The role of non-formal education becomes even more relevant in the context of developing countries where significant asymmetries in access to education emerge. This study adopts the Solutions Story Tracker provided by the Solutions Journalism Network to identify and explore solutions based on journalism stories in the non-formal education field. A total of 256 stories are identified and categorized into 14 dimensions. The findings reveal that practical, participatory, and volunteering dimensions are the three most common dimensions in these non-formal education initiatives. Furthermore, two emerging dimensions related to empowerment and sustainability are identified, allowing us to extend the theoretical knowledge in the non-formal education field. These conclusions are relevant for establishing public policies that can involve greater participation by local communities in non-formal education and for addressing sustainability challenges through bottom-up initiatives.
